Achieve purified, smooth, toned skin and supple, voluminous hair with rhassoul—a natural volcanic clay from Morocco that gently cleanses both body and hair.

Rich in calcium, magnesium, iron, and aluminum, this traditional clay cleanses more gently than soap, free from harsh surfactants that can strip skin and hair.

3. Sanitizing and Volumizing Hair

This rhassoul treatment strengthens hair, adds shine, eliminates dandruff, and boosts volume—outperforming many salon options.

For quick results against dandruff and oily scalp, you'll need:

- 4 tablespoons of rhassoul

- 1 tablespoon of baking soda to remove residue from styling products

- Warm water added gradually

Instructions:

1. Mix into a homogeneous, thick paste in a bowl.

2. Apply to clean, damp hair.

3. Massage scalp lightly to avoid irritation. No foam is normal.

4. Leave on for 20 minutes, then rinse with lukewarm water.

Your hair will emerge clean, sanitized, and full of volume. Repeat after shampoos as needed for a dandruff-free, shiny scalp.

Like a natural blotter, rhassoul absorbs excess sebum, removes dead skin, cleanses, and fortifies skin and hair. Hypoallergenic and suitable for all skin types—even children's and the eye area.
